Just like that, the UMBC Retrievers' historic Cinderella run has come to an end, but not before the Under Armour-sponsored team got hooked up with Stephen Curry's latest.

Ahead of yesterday's second round loss to Kansas State, the UMBC men's team took to Twitter to show off a shipment of "Pi Day" Curry 5s for the whole team. 

The Retrievers made history Friday by ousting the Virginia Cavaliers, making UMBC the first No. 16 seed team to defeat a No. 1 seed in the men's college basketball tournament.

Under Armour released the "Pi Day" sneakers Thursday in celebration of Curry's birthday. The shoes, which retail for $130, sold out that night, but will be restocked April 14.
